Key Responsibilities
  • Vendor Scoping & Research
    • Continuous Market research for best fit payroll vendors and new developments, via networking, online searching, surveys and references, in a global capacity.
    • Map out key criteria in Disaster Recovery, Change Management, Audit & Reconciliation, Quality Control, Data Security, Data Accuracy, Compliance, Timely Processing and present best options.
    • Develop and deploy questionnaires, schedule demo's with key stakeholders and create cost analysis.
    • Present to stakeholders and leadership on recommendations based on findings and trends
  • New Country Expansion
    • Project manage end to end for all new country onboarding. From vendor selection, to contract negotiations, mitigate legal risks, stakeholder alignment, system & data migration, testing & comms.
  • Payroll Vendor Relations & Performance Evaluation
    • Review company best practices to ensure maximum client satisfaction.
    • Identify and optimize communication and collaborations with with external partners.
    • Work with cross functional teams internally to ensure payroll vendors meet Remote’s expectations and agreed SLAs and established KPIs.
  • Cost Tracking & Analysis
    • Review Invoices and track billed costs versus agreed contractual terms and report to leadership any anomalies.
    • Document and chart out costs for countries or departments. Initiate and follow through on cost discussions either internally or with the vendors.
    • Headcount and legal entity cost analysis for the business, to improve efficiencies and scaling of the business.
  • Communication & Collaboration
    • Work closely with internal teams such as Tax, FP&A, Legal, Security, Operations and Onboarding teams to develop successful deployment of new Payroll Solutions.
    • Identify key challenges to deployment, share with appropriate internal teams and provide solutions to overcome identified challenges.
    • Develop training plan for participants to ensure consumption of resources

Remote's Total Rewards philosophy is to ensure fair, unbiased compensation and fair equity pay along with competitive benefits in all locations in which we operate. We do not agree to or encourage cheap-labor practices and therefore we ensure to pay above in-location rates. We hope to inspire other companies to support global talent-hiring and bring local wealth to developing countries.

At first glance our salary bands seem quite wide - here is some context. At Remote we have international operations and a globally distributed workforce. We use geo ranges to consider geographic pay differentials as part of our global compensation strategy to remain competitive in various markets while we hiring globally.

Our salary ranges are determined by role, level and location, and our job titles may span more than one career level. The actual base pay for the successful candidate in this role is dependent upon many factors such as location, transferable or job-related skills, work experience, relevant training, business needs, and market demands. The base salary range may be subject to change.

At Remote, we foster internal mobility as a key element of our culture of employee growth and development, supported by a compensation philosophy that guarantees pay equity and fairness. Therefore, all compensation changes associated with an internal move will be reviewed by the Total Rewards & People Enablement team on a case by case basis.
